WebJul 18, 2014 · Of the 20 most common surnames in Italy, only 2 of them are found here. Marino twice and Rizzo once. Both of them are predominantly Southern Italian rather than pan-Italian names. Lombardi is one of the most popular surnames in Italy, but it is instead Lombardo that is found more often in Sicily and Calabria, as seen here. alfieb WebBLOG by Tour of Sicily; Useful to Know.
